The mission of the Community Action Commission (CAC) in Harrisburg, Pennsylvania's capital city, is to create and maximize the resources necessary for individuals and families to achieve self-sufficiency. The Commission works primarily with and on behalf of low-income individuals and families in Pennsylvania's capital city region (Cumberland, Dauphin, and Perry Counties). |
